Возможно ли выполнить синхронизированное выполнение в Netbeans? - PullRequest
0 голосов
/ 26 мая 2011

Я хочу выполнить синхронизированное выполнение для сравнения двух логик.

Возможно ли в Netbeans сделать это или мне нужно реализовать код?

РЕДАКТИРОВАТЬ : Я хочу, чтобы программа выполнялась в течение определенного времени и после этой остановки / выключения, а не измеряла, сколько времени было потрачено на ее выполнение.

1 Ответ

1 голос
/ 26 мая 2011

изменить: с учетом вашего редактирования -

РЕДАКТИРОВАТЬ: я хочу, чтобы программа выполнялась в течение определенного времени и после этого остановки / выключения, а не измерять, сколько времени было потрачено на выполнение.

Тогда использование Java-объекта Calendar - это именно то, что вам нужно. Вы можете вызвать метод из него, который возвращает время в миллисекундах. Просто продолжайте конвертировать, пока не получите желаемую единицу сравнения (минуты, часы и т. Д.).

Или, что еще лучше, вы можете создать минимальный, но полный класс, который обеспечивает необходимую функциональность без необходимости жестко кодировать значения преобразования:].


Я не уверен на 100%, что вы подразумеваете под «в Netbeans» или «реализацией кода»? Если вы хотите, чтобы программа постоянно запускалась до определенного времени, а затем выполняла метод по истечении этого времени, то это не составило бы затруднений.

API Java имеет объекты Calendar, которые могут возвращать время:

Calendar now = Calendar.getInstance();
...